Been planning on doing this for a while, finally planned it all out and dove in<br />
<br />
I purchased a set of used cams from a 2011 1NZ-FE <b>(s<span style="text-decoration: underline">uitable year range is 2006-2011</span>) </b>for rouchly $114 after tax and shipping, with the intention of using only the intake cam in the swap<br />
<br />
The old intake cam is 4mm of lift (and have a egg shape curve to them) while the new one is 6mm (much more tear drop shaped)<br />
<br />
The swap can be done entirely in the engine bay<br />

      <content:encoded><![CDATA[Has anyone else tried boring out the throttle body?<br />
<br />
I had the throttle body bored out from 55mm to 58mm, per a friend&#039;s recommendation as he did it to his Prius.  The change in air flow is minor enough for the ECU to adjust, and the additional air flow helps the car keep up on the highway.
